Convert time to radians
mm_to_radian.Rd
This function converts time values into radians, which is often used in circular statistics and time-of-day analyses.

Details
This function converts time values into radians based on a 24-hour clock:
A full day (24 hours) corresponds to \(2\pi\) radians.
The fractional time of the day is calculated as: $$\text{Fraction of the day} = \frac{\text{hours}}{24} + \frac{\text{minutes}}{1440} + \frac{\text{seconds}}{86400}$$
For example, for a time of 23 hours, 6 minutes, and 12 seconds: $$\text{Fraction of the day} = \frac{23}{24} + \frac{6}{1440} + \frac{12}{86400}$$
To convert this fraction into radians: $$\text{Radians} = \text{Fraction of the day} \times 2\pi$$
